> As multiple platform profile handlers may come and go, send a notification
> to userspace each time that a platform profile handler is registered or
> unregistered.
>
> Tested-by: Matthew Schwartz <matthew.schwa...@linux.dev>
> Signed-off-by: Mario Limonciello <mario.limoncie...@amd.com>
> ---
>  drivers/acpi/platform_profile.c | 3 +++
>  1 file changed, 3 insertions(+)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/acpi/platform_profile.c 
> b/drivers/acpi/platform_profile.c
> index 57c66d7dbf827..7bd32f1e8d834 100644
> --- a/drivers/acpi/platform_profile.c
> +++ b/drivers/acpi/platform_profile.c
> @@ -182,6 +182,7 @@ int platform_profile_register(struct 
> platform_profile_handler *pprof)
>       if (err)
>               return err;
>       list_add_tail(&pprof->list, &platform_profile_handler_list);
> +     sysfs_notify(acpi_kobj, NULL, "platform_profile");
> 
>       cur_profile = pprof;
>       return 0;
> @@ -195,6 +196,8 @@ int platform_profile_remove(struct 
> platform_profile_handler *pprof)
>       list_del(&pprof->list);
> 
>       cur_profile = NULL;
> +
> +     sysfs_notify(acpi_kobj, NULL, "platform_profile");
>       if (!platform_profile_is_registered())
>               sysfs_remove_group(acpi_kobj, &platform_profile_group);
> 
> -- 
> 2.43.0
